Local Environment Considerations
Comprehending local environment factors to consider is necessary for property owners intending a roofing system substitute project. The environment can considerably influence the option of roof materials and installment methods. As an example, areas with hefty rainfall might require products that are immune to wetness, while areas prone to heats may gain from reflective roof to lower heat absorption. Furthermore, home owners should think about regional wind patterns that can affect the longevity of the roofing system. In cooler environments, insulation and snow lots capabilities are important to assure structural stability. Understanding these factors helps house owners make informed decisions that line up with their regional climate condition, inevitably boosting the roof covering's long life and performance. Cautious preparation based upon climate can bring about an effective roof covering project.

Frequently Asked Questions

Exactly how Lengthy Does a Normal Roofing Substitute Take?
A common roofing substitute typically takes one to three days, depending on the dimension and intricacy of the roofing. Climate condition and crew efficiency can additionally affect the overall period of the task.

Just how Do I Dispose of My Old Roof Materials?
To throw away old roof products, one ought to call local waste administration solutions for standards. Several locations have reusing programs, while others might call for unique disposal sites for unsafe materials like tiles and underlayments.
What Should I Do if My Roofing System Leaks During Substitute?
If a roofing leaks throughout replacement, the contractor needs to quickly cover the damaged location with a water resistant tarp. They should assess the damage and repair any type of leaks to stop more issues prior to continuing the task.
